Schools Across Saudi Arabia Celebrate Founding Day

Schools across Saudi Arabia have commenced, on Sunday, celebrations of “Founding Day,” which falls annually on February 22, under the theme “Our Story.”

Saudi Gazette reports that diverse range of special programs and activities were organized to commemorate “this significant national occasion”.

Donning special costumes to mark the occasion, students are enthusiastically participating in the festivities, including artistic performances.

The Kingdom’s Ministry of Education outlined a comprehensive plan encompassing a variety of cultural and educational activities designed for students, staff, parents, and the community.

Key initiatives include seminars and educational sessions on the historical milestones of the Saudi state since its founding, as well as cultural and historical competitions to enhance students’ knowledge of the Kingdom’s history and foster a strong sense of national pride.

Diverse activities of the celebration will continue for two weeks as part of an integrated communication strategy.

This initiative aims to deepen understanding of the Kingdom’s history and inculcate national values in the hearts and minds of students and members of all educational sectors.
